    I am playing around with some of the sites from the site library in order to understand how things were constructed. I have installed a copy of Wordsmith and have an issue with the single blog post pages. By default these pages have no sidebar but the Blog Archive page does have a sidebar. My aim was to have a sidebar on the single posts too so I used the customizer via Layout>Sidebars>Single Post Sidebar Layout and changed the setting to Content/Sidebar.

    This did add a sidebar but for some reason both the main section and sidebar on single posts are narrower than the same sections as seen on the archives pages. Is there another setting I need to tweak

    Hi there,

    Wordsmith uses a Layout Element:

    https://docs.generatepress.com/article/layout-element-overview/

    You will find it in Dashboard > Appearance > Elements.

    The element titled: Blog Posts Width is the one that defines the Content width for the single post.
    You can simply delete this element if you want it to conform to the customizer settings.
